Subject: Cut-over complete — Addressly widget v4

Hello plugin authors,

The migration of the Addressly autocomplete widget to the new suggestion backend finished last night without rollback. Response shapes are unchanged, but the debounce default dropped from 400ms to 250ms, and empty-query requests are now rejected. Please verify your plugins against the staging sandbox before Friday. Legacy endpoints stay live for thirty days. Your integration environment should use the following configuration:

service settings:
quenath:
  log_level: info
  metrics_host: metrics.quenath.tolvaqlabs.internal
  pin: 1407
  pool_size: 8

# Vantrell Line Pricing — Managers Only

Vantrell Core stays at current list. Vantrell Plus rises 6% in Q3; Vantrell Max holds pending the Orvale channel review. Discounts above 12% need director sign-off. No public communication until the rollout memo ships. For the incoming director, the strategic reasoning behind these moves is summarized directly below.

board note of bawep-tajef: Queniusek Systems plans to raise the Quenvan list price by 53.1 percent in March. The pricing group signed off on a budget of $176.4 million for Project Drueth. The renewal with Casionix Partners closes at $142.5 million a year, 8.3 percent below the last contract. Project Fraax slips by six weeks because of the tooling delay.

The default ramp profile for checkout-flow load tests now starts at 50 virtual users instead of 200, and think-time jitter is enabled by default. This reduces false-positive latency alerts seen during the Brindlewood release cycle. Payment-stub timeouts were also raised to match the new gateway mock in Ferrow. Existing test plans keep their explicit settings; only unset fields pick up the new defaults. For the release notes, the new default configuration shipped with this version is listed below.

settings of yahaf-tahop:
jorox:
  pin: 5851
  tenant: noveth
  seal: seal_7ddb5c42
  metrics_host: metrics.jorox.ordinnet.example
  standby_team: wenax
  escalation: oliath-feneth
  nonce: 552548